AI analysis of satellite images shows 1990s USSR collapse increased methane emissions, despite lower oil, gas production

Summary by Ground News
Methane emissions in Turkmenistan increased in the years following the dissolution of the Soviet Union. One molecule of methane has more heat-trapping power than CO2, and its half-life in the atmosphere is just a decade. Methane is sometimes even burned, or flared, if it is not the main target of exploration.
